This is not a "pocket veto". A pocket veto is a term to describe what happens when the President takes no action and Congress is adjourned. When this happens, the bill does not become law. So it is the same as if he had vetoed it.
Now when the President takes no action and Congress is not adjourned, then the bill does become law. Again, it requires no action on the President's part.
